Legal Highs Online: Are They Safe & Permissible ?

The proliferation of online retailers selling so-called "legal highs" has sparked serious questions regarding their security and permissibility . These substances, often marketed as “research chemicals” or “novel psychoactive substances,” frequently evade existing drug laws by subtly modifying their chemical structure . Nevertheless , the quick evolution of these chemicals makes it difficult for lawmakers to appropriately regulate them, leading to a gray area . Basically, the health risks associated with consuming these experimental substances are largely unknown, and their procurement online carries significant risks .

The Rise of Legal Highs: Online Sales & Concerns

The growth of novel psychoactive substances, often dubbed “research chemicals”, has ignited significant worry due to their increasing availability online. Websites are actively selling these materials directly to consumers, bypassing conventional retail routes and often leveraging loopholes in existing legislation. This convenient access, coupled with limited knowledge of their likely hazards, presents a critical danger to public safety and has prompted calls for stricter regulation and additional investigation into their long-term effects.
